Understanding the Essentials of Guerrilla Marketing Tactics
Guerrilla marketing thrives on creativity and unconventional strategies that capture attention without requiring substantial financial resources. By leveraging existing public spaces, brands can create a powerful connection with their audience. Some key tactics include:
- Ambush Marketing: Positioning your brand in the right place at the right time to reap the benefits of competitors’ larger campaigns.
- Street Art: Utilizing urban environments as your canvas to turn everyday locations into your advertising platform.
- Flash Mobs: Organizing surprise performances that double as promotions, viral sensations that amp up brand visibility.

Innovative Campaign Ideas That Drive Engagement and Awareness
To truly capture your audience’s attention, consider implementing interactive installations in high-traffic areas. These eye-catching displays encourage people to engage with your brand while providing a memorable experience. Some innovative ideas include:
- Augmented Reality Experiences: Allow passersby to interact through their smartphones, turning everyday moments into extraordinary encounters.
- Flash Mobs: Organize a surprise performance that aligns with your brand message, creating excitement and buzz around your campaign.
- Street Art Collaborations: Partner with local artists to create murals that reflect your brand’s identity, enhancing community connection.
Another compelling approach is leveraging the power of social media challenges. Encouraging users to participate in fun and shareable challenges can significantly boost brand visibility. A few examples include:
- Photo Contests: Invite customers to share photos using your product with a specific hashtag, enhancing community engagement.
- Video Challenges: Encourage users to create short videos showcasing creative uses of your product, fostering innovation and fun.
- Team Challenges: Promote group participation by aligning challenges with social causes, empowering your customers to contribute to meaningful outcomes.
